Passiflora is the South Pacific version of our Multiflora DIPA. Coming in at 9.6% and utilizing a blend of New Zealand hops, this brew produces notes of guava, citrus, and passionfruit.

1 Pint can
Served in a stemless wine glass
This beer pours yellow and turbid. It looks like pineapple juice only a shade darker. It is topped with an inch of tan head that leaves decent lacing.
The smell is fantastic. I get citrus and tropical fruit.
It has a big juicy flavor. Tropical fruit dominates with a little grapefruit to add some bitterness.
Medium bodied with a creamy mouthfeel
This is my first beer from Decadent. It is a very impressive beer.

This opaquely cloudy tap pour is pale yellow with a 1 cm foam cap. The aroma is tropical fruit and resin. The flavor is mango-pineapple-tangerine. The hop bitterness is moderate to strong and is full of resin, but the mouthfeel is smooth.
